Hydropeptide Anti-Wrinkle Dark Circle Concentrate is a collagen boosting, wrinkle fighter as well as the enemy of dark circles.

Attention panda-eyed people everywhere. This eye cream is a forceful eliminator of dark under eye circles. The key active is hesperidin methyl chalcone. One study documented that it lowers the filtration rate of capillaries, and less blood flowing though capillaries close to the surface of the skin.

Other ingredients for dark circles incude licorice, vitamin K, pearl powder and skin brightening bearberry leaf extract.

There are plenty of other impressive ingredients including the power peptides, Matrixyl 3000, tripeptide-1 and dipeptide 2. Plus there's a ton of antioxidant botanical extracts such as tea, pea and rosemary. Gynostemma pentaphyllum leaf extract is antioxidant and anti-inflammatory, according to a Taiwanese study.

Ceramide-2 helps the delicate eye area skin retain moisture.

    I've used this morning and night for five weeks. I took pictures immediately before I started using it and at four weeks. When I compared the pictures, I couldn't detect any lightening of dark circles or change in my fine lines. (For context, my genetic dark circles are very bad, and, at 39, I have very fine lines under my eyes.) However, the bottle says that it "brightens, de-puffs, unwrinkles and beautifies." It doesn't claim to get rid of either dark circles or wrinkles, so I think this product does live up to its claims.My fine lines are still there, but this cream makes them seem less apparent. It definitely has an immediate brightening effect, helping to diffuse the light away from my dark circles. And it is very hydrating and works well under concealer. Overall, I think it really does beautify my whole eye area. I'll try other eye creams to see if they help more with dark circles, but for hydration and overall beautification, I like this eye cream.

    Since I was a teenager I had dark circles under my eyes and have been searching for the perfect remedy. I am now in my mid-thirties and fine lines started creeping up on me. I could no longer apply concealer as deliberately – as this one particularly fine line would be accentuated by residual makeup.
    I have been using the cream for a month, applying it twice a day. My dark circles have been lightened. The improvement was incremental and not significant to the point of making them disappear; nevertheless it was apparent enough for me to tell the difference. As to the fine line – my indicator of how well this cream acts as an anti-aging product, I would say that it didn’t become more noticeable with or without makeup on.
    The pump design is poorly done and I’m sure the bottle won’t last for as long as it should be, and it wasn’t doing much on my bags. I will consider buying another bottle once I’ve gone down my list of other eye creams and if I still have not found my Holy Grail.
